One Week Post Op Food Ideas

I am one week post op and I am on a full liquid diet. I seriously want to sink my teeth into something... Any idea for meals?

  • Replies 5
  • Views 731
  • Created
  • Last Reply

Top Posters In This Topic

Featured Replies

Full liquids I was allowed to have sf Popsicles, sf fudge pops, and sf freezer pops..

Or try making your liquids into little Popsicles. Stick em in an ice tray with a tooth pick (:

At one week I was only allowed clear liquids and protein shakes. It was nice to be able to "chew" SF popsicles. It doesn't last forever. Try not to rush through your food stages. I had a particularly long food progression (couldn't even have cottage cheese until week 8). But I SWEAR it helped break the "head" hunger issues I've had to deal with for years! Good luck!

On full liquids I was allowed greek yogurt and it really made me feel full. I also was allowed cream Soups that had been strained. I like Anderson's Split Pea. It was filling and sat well, which other brands of split pea did not.
